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57346 5128934 5213316152 8158097901 80
68720 2681788845
68720 2681788845
284686 2313317127 61 11699
All about undefined
Interested in learning more?
68720 2681788845
284686 2313317127 61 11699
See more
515 74
2927741 4257 5659554
See more
482976 43211035925 04443879160
88514247 09 33195737
See more